Trump Says Exxon Will Enter Venezuela as Oil Investment Ramps Up

President Donald Trump said ExxonMobil Holdings Corporation (NYSE:XOM) is among the major oil companies preparing to enter Venezuela, signaling a potential reversal of Exxon’s nearly two-decade absence from the country. How ExxonMobil’s Bid for Shell’s U.S. Chemicals Assets Could Reshape the XOM Investment Story

Earlier this week, reports emerged that ExxonMobil Holdings joined several bidders for Shell’s U.S. chemicals division, an asset spanning four plants in Louisiana, Texas, and Pennsylvania that could be sold for about US$8.00 billion as Shell continues to reshape its portfolio through disposals. This potential acquisition would deepen ExxonMobil’s footprint in U.S. chemicals at a time when Shell is monetizing assets that recently contributed meaningfully to its quarterly earnings.
